Description.

Subshrub 0.5–2 m high, stems conspicuously pilose. Leaves petiolate, lamina 6–14 × 2–4 cm, variable in shape, commonly broadly oblong, sometimes, ovate, oblong-elliptic or oblanceolate, shortly acuminate, base attenuate and sometimes decurrent on the petiole, thinly or densely pilose on the veins, especially beneath; petioles 0.2–2.5 cm, hirsute. Inflorescence of simple or branched spikes 5–15 cm long from the upper leaf axils, these often aggregated to form a terminal panicle of spikes; rhachis and axes glandular and somewhat sticky; bracts linear-oblong, 4–5 × 1–2 mm, glandular, bracteoles similar but shorter; calyx 4 - lobed to base, lobes 4–5 × 1 mm, lanceolate, glandular; corolla 9–10 (– 12) mm long cream with purple “ herring bone ” patterning on lower lip, glandular, tube short, stout, 2.5 mm wide, lips short 4–5 mm; pollen prolate 40 × 21 μm, 2 - aperturate, colporate, 1 row of indistinct insulae on either side of the aperture (Fig. 51 A View Figure 51 ). Capsule 14–17 × 3 mm, clavate, constricted between seeds, covered in subsessile glands, 4 - seeded; seeds 3 mm diam., tuberculate.

Phenology.

Found in flower throughout most of the year, but perhaps flowering most prolifically in the June – September period.

Habitat.

Subtropical forest, secondary bushland, cliffs, scrubby slopes, roadsides between 500 and 1500 m.

Distribution.

Widely distributed in dispersed but locally extensive colonies in Peru, Argentina, Brazil and Bolivia. In Peru almost restricted to Junín in the centre of the country, where it is abundant, constituting a very curious distribution, somewhat parallelling that of Justicia tenuiflora , as both species are locally common further south in Bolivia. Typification.

As GZU- 000250360 is the only specimen of Pohl 1989 annotated by Nees, it must be assumed to be the holotype of Sarotheca elegans , even though the Vienna specimen, W- 0049983, is much more complete.

Notes.

The inflorescence can be of axillary spikes or aggregated to form a terminal panicle of spikes. The indumentum of the corolla and capsules is of subsessile glands.
